Germinates in 7-14 days at 15°C-18°C. Grow on then plant out six weeks later in August/early September. Thin/Plant Out: Transplant to flowering position in autumn allowing plenty of space for the foliage and roots to develop before winter sets in. Allow a minimum of 30cm per plant. WebJun 5, 2024 · Wallflowers to grow - Erysimum bicolor 'Bowles's Mauve'. Erysimum 'Bowles's Mauve' is a popular perennial shrub, bearing masses of purple blooms from March to November – in warmer regions it can flower for even longer. Sterile, it bears no pollen but is a great nectar plant for butterflies and other pollinators. H x S: 45cm x 50cm. sharepoint list planner integration

WebApr 10, 2024 · How to grow and propagate erysimum. Wallflowers prefer light, well drained soils and full sun. A warm, open position will bring out the scent of the blooms. Left to their own devices, perennial erysimums have a tendency to become woody and leggy. They fizzle out within four to five years, usually succumbing over winter.
